Summary (Exploring the properties of metal ions using a hot flame)
Summary
You have seen that each element has its own ‘signature’ emission line spectrum and this can be used to identify elements. The lines arise because light is emitted when electrons move from an excited energy state to a lower energy state or the ground state.
